That's a shame. Thanks for tying though. I've only ever had two centrecaps. For what it's worth, I paid $265 delivered for my set of 4 Supra rims out of the trading post. Came with 2x near new Bridgstone Eager 235/60/14s. Rims were in worse condition than I was led to believe, I spent ages cleaning them up then restored them by hand by stripping the clearcoat and sanding back the machined groves to a uniform plain metal. Lotta hard work. Had to get centrering rings made for two of them too ($55), as I later realised they had been bored out slighlty to fit on front Datsun hubs. Basically bought the tyres for the rims - the huge tyres are still sitting in the garage.
